Can a FAST Bank to Bank Box be upgraded to Sequential? If so, does anybody know how much the upgrade costs? Is it a Firmware change or simply a Software change (unlocking something)?

I also would like to know how much to convert the box to use a Crank Trigger's Pickup with an EDist from a box configured for an LT1 Ignition.

Last question, is the LS1 specific EDist wiring setup to use the LS1 Cam Sensor's signal?

Near as I can tell the only difference between the LS1 edist and the standard one is that the LS1 box does not have coil drivers in it. It sents out a EST signal that the LS1 coils recogize. The other edist can drive any coil.

Regarding the eDIST, the only difference is that the LS1 specific version's harness is wired to use the EST signal and the LS1 firing order. The box itself is identical. You can get the universal part and wire it yourself for use with the LS1.

Yes you can upgrade a Bank to Bank system to Sequential. The cost is roughly $600.00. I have done this for Customers in the past. It does require sending the ECU to FAST.

From the edist intructions

Coil outputs (see pinout chart for wire colors)
The coil outputs are only available on eDist part number 30-5000 and are not
available with eDist part number 30-5001. These outputs can fire a coil directly by
connecting them to the negative side of an ignition coil. The order in which these
outputs are wired varies with an engine’s firing order and cam sensor timing. This is
described in the “wiring the outputs” section of this manual.

305000 is the universal 305001 is the LS1
